WHAT ARE LARDER CUPBOARDS AND WHY ARE THEY SO POPULAR IN THE UK?

Larder cupboards are tall, freestanding or integrated storage units designed specifically for organising food, dry goods, and kitchen essentials. Traditionally inspired by classic pantry designs, modern larder cupboards have evolved to suit contemporary kitchens while retaining their core purpose: structured, accessible storage.

The popularity of larder cupboards in the UK has surged due to several factors:

Space optimisation in smaller kitchens
The shift towards organised, clutter-free living
Increased interest in home cooking and meal prep
Aesthetic appeal that enhances kitchen design

Unlike standard cupboards, larder cupboards offer vertical storage with internal shelving, racks, and compartments that allow you to categorise items efficiently. This makes them especially valuable in UK homes where space is often limited and every inch matters.

TYPES OF LARDER CUPBOARDS AVAILABLE IN THE UK

When searching for larder cupboards, understanding the different types available is crucial. Each type caters to specific kitchen layouts and storage needs.

Freestanding larder cupboards

These are versatile units that can be placed anywhere in the kitchen. Ideal for renters or those who prefer flexibility, freestanding larder cupboards are available in various sizes and finishes.

Built-in larder cupboards

Designed to integrate seamlessly into fitted kitchens, built-in larder cupboards provide a sleek, cohesive look. They often feature pull-out mechanisms and custom shelving for maximum efficiency.

Slimline larder cupboards

Perfect for narrow spaces, slimline options are ideal for smaller UK kitchens. They make use of vertical height without taking up too much floor space.

Double-door larder cupboards

These larger units offer expansive storage and are suitable for families or those who require more space for groceries and kitchen essentials.

Corner larder cupboards

Designed to utilise awkward corner spaces, these cupboards help maximise storage in kitchens with unconventional layouts.

HOW TO CHOOSE THE RIGHT LARDER CUPBOARDS FOR YOUR KITCHEN

Selecting the right larder cupboards involves more than just aesthetics. It requires careful consideration of space, usage, and long-term practicality.

Assess your kitchen layout

Measure your available space accurately. Consider ceiling height, wall space, and proximity to cooking areas. Larder cupboards work best when placed near food preparation zones.

Determine your storage needs

Think about what you plan to store. Dry goods, tins, spices, appliances, or cleaning supplies all require different configurations.

Consider accessibility

Look for features such as pull-out shelves, adjustable racks, and soft-close doors. These elements significantly improve usability.

Match your kitchen style

Choose a finish and design that complements your kitchen. Whether you prefer modern minimalism or traditional charm, larder cupboards come in a wide range of styles.

Evaluate durability

Opt for high-quality materials that can withstand daily use. Solid construction ensures longevity and better value over time.

KEY FEATURES TO LOOK FOR IN HIGH-QUALITY LARDER CUPBOARDS

When browsing larder cupboards in the UK market, certain features stand out as essential for both functionality and convenience.

Adjustable shelving

Allows you to customise the interior based on your storage needs.

Door-mounted racks

Perfect for storing spices, jars, and smaller items, making them easily accessible.

Pull-out drawers

Ideal for deeper storage areas, ensuring nothing gets lost at the back.

Ventilation

Prevents moisture build-up and keeps food items fresher for longer.

Soft-close hinges

Enhance the overall experience and reduce wear and tear.

SPACE-SAVING IDEAS USING LARDER CUPBOARDS

Maximising space is a top priority in UK homes, and larder cupboards excel in this area.

Use vertical storage

Take full advantage of height by storing less frequently used items at the top.

Categorise items

Group similar items together for easier access and better organisation.

Incorporate baskets and containers

These help keep smaller items tidy and prevent clutter.

Utilise door space

Install hooks or racks inside doors for additional storage.

Rotate stock regularly

Keep older items at the front to ensure nothing goes to waste.

FAQ SECTION

What are larder cupboards used for?
Larder cupboards are used to store food, dry goods, and kitchen essentials in an organised and accessible way.

Are larder cupboards suitable for small kitchens?
Yes, slimline and vertical designs make them ideal for maximising space in smaller UK kitchens.

Do larder cupboards need to be fixed to the wall?
Freestanding units do not necessarily require fixing, but securing them can add stability and safety.

What is the best material for larder cupboards?
Durable materials such as solid wood or high-quality engineered wood are commonly preferred.

How do I organise a larder cupboard effectively?
Use categories, containers, and adjustable shelving to create a structured layout.
